M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ER REGARDING VENUE
Petitioner Nickelas Necessity Brewer, an inmate confined in the Bowie County Correctional
Center, proceeding pro se, filed this petition for writ of habeas corpus.
According to the website operated by the Arkansas Department of Corrections, petitioner was
previously convicted of residential burglary in Craighead County, Arkansas. Petitioner references
the indictment for this offense in his petition. Petitioner states that on August 3, 2017, he was
forcibly transferred from the custody of the Arkansas Department of Corrections to the Bowie
County Correctional Center in Texarkana, Texas. Petitioner states no charges have been filed against
him in Texas.
Pursuant to 28 U.S.C. § 2241(d), a petitioner may bring his petition for writ of habeas corpus
in either the federal judicial district in which he was convicted or the district in which he is
incarcerated. As petitioner states no Texas charges have been filed against him, his incarceration
in the Bowie County Correctional Center appears to be the result of some contractual arrangement
between the Center and the Arkansas Department of Corrections. Accordingly, his incarceration is
due to his Arkansas conviction rather than any action by a Texas court.
As petitioner’s incarceration is the result of an Arkansas conviction, the Court is of the
opinion this petition should be transferred to the federal judicial district where a petitioner physically
incarcerated in Arkansas would file a petition challenging an Arkansas conviction. Pursuant to 28
U.S.C. § 83, Craighead County, where petitioner was convicted, is located in the Jonesboro Division
of the Eastern District of Arkansas. This petition will therefore be transferred to such division and
district.
ORDER
For the reasons set forth above, it is ORDERED that this petition is TRANSFERRED to
the Jonesboro Division of the United States District Court for the Eastern District of Arkansas.
